The mechanism of the decrease in cytosolic Ca(2+) concentrations induced by angiotensin II in the high K(+)-depolarized rabbit femoral artery
1. Using front-surface fluorometry of fura-2-loaded strips, and measuring the transmembrane (45)Ca(2+) fluxes of ring preparations of the rabbit femoral artery, the mechanism underlying a sustained decrease in the cytosolic Ca(2+) concentration ([Ca(2+)](i)) induced by angiotensin II (AT-II) was inv...
